Dhaka, July 17 -- Home Affairs Adviser Lt Gen (retd) Md Jahangir Alam Chowdhury said Thursday that 25 people have been arrested over Wednesday's violence surrounding a National Citizen Party (NCP) rally in Gopalganj, and that operations will continue until all those involved are brought to justice.
Speaking to reporters at the Secretariat, the adviser said 10 police personnel were injured in the clashes-two have already been admitted to the Central Police Hospital in Rajarbagh, with three more en route from Gopalganj.
He confirmed that the law and order situation in the area is now under control following the imposition of a 22-hour curfew starting 8pm Wednesday. The curfew was declared after incidents of vandalism, arson, and cocktail ...
